Sqlserver
 sql >> Base de données >  >> RDS >> Sqlserver

5 avantages de la surveillance proactive des performances de la base de données

Les administrateurs de base de données ont de nombreuses responsabilités, de la gestion générale de la base de données à la planification des capacités, en passant par la haute disponibilité et la reprise après sinistre. Avec autant de fers dans le feu, les administrateurs de base de données devraient adopter une surveillance proactive des bases de données pour les aider à rester sains d'esprit (et les performances de leur base de données).

La surveillance proactive de la base de données consiste à suivre les métriques de la base de données afin que les problèmes de performances soient identifiés tôt, avant qu'ils ne causent des problèmes majeurs. La surveillance proactive élimine une partie du stress lié à la maintenance des bases de données, car les DBA n'ont pas à vivre en mode réactif, éteignant constamment feu après feu.

Avec la multitude d'outils sur le marché aujourd'hui, la mise en place d'une surveillance proactive des bases de données n'est pas difficile, et le temps gagné pour avoir identifié et résolu les problèmes de performances plus tôt compense largement l'effort initial.

Si vous en avez assez d'être à la merci des besoins de performances de vos bases de données, il est temps de tirer parti de ces cinq avantages de la surveillance proactive des bases de données.

La surveillance proactive de la base de données réduit le besoin de dépannage d'urgence

Lorsque vous devez constamment tout supprimer pour résoudre les problèmes de performances de la base de données, il est facile de perdre de vue la cause initiale du problème. Obtenir et maintenir votre système en ligne est toujours la première priorité d'un DBA. Si vos bases de données lancent constamment des alertes, il reste peu de temps pour explorer et traiter la cause première.

La mise en œuvre d'une stratégie de surveillance proactive fournit aux administrateurs de base de données des données qui montrent les changements dans les fonctions de la base de données au fur et à mesure qu'ils se produisent afin que les administrateurs de base de données puissent corriger les problèmes tôt avant qu'ils n'affectent négativement les performances.

En suivant ces métriques au fil du temps, les administrateurs de bases de données peuvent plus facilement voir d'où proviennent les problèmes récurrents, ce qui réduit le temps passé à chercher aveuglément la cause.

La surveillance proactive de la base de données libère du temps pour travailler sur des projets à forte valeur ajoutée

Lorsque les administrateurs de base de données n'éteignent pas les performances, ils ont de nombreuses responsabilités qui font partie intégrante du succès d'une entreprise. Les administrateurs de bases de données travaillent non seulement dans les coulisses pour garantir l'exécution ininterrompue des opérations internes, mais ils maintiennent également la sécurité et l'intégrité de la base de données, entre autres tâches critiques.

La surveillance proactive des bases de données permet aux administrateurs de base de données d'automatiser les tâches répétitives mais chronophages afin qu'ils soient libres de travailler sur d'autres tâches à plus forte valeur ajoutée qui profitent directement aux objectifs commerciaux de l'organisation.

La surveillance proactive de la base de données identifie les opportunités de croissance et d'amélioration

Le suivi des mesures de performances au fil du temps indique les zones de la base de données qui doivent être ajustées. Les longs temps d'attente, les requêtes lentes et l'utilisation excessive des ressources ne sont que quelques exemples de mesures de performances qui peuvent être surveillées de manière proactive pour identifier les problèmes au sein du système.

Une fois les fonctions problématiques identifiées, le réglage des performances peut optimiser le système pour qu'il fonctionne plus efficacement, ce qui améliorera la qualité globale de l'expérience utilisateur, tant en interne qu'en externe.

La réalisation régulière de vérifications de l'état planifiées dans le cadre d'une stratégie proactive de surveillance des performances de la base de données est une autre façon pour les administrateurs de base de données de rester conscients des problèmes de performances de SQL Server afin qu'ils puissent prioriser et résoudre les problèmes les plus critiques en premier.

La surveillance proactive de la base de données fournit des alertes précoces pour les changements de disponibilité et de consommation de ressources

L'un des meilleurs moyens de surveiller de manière proactive vos bases de données pour les problèmes de performances consiste à vous assurer que vous tirez pleinement parti des options d'alarme de vos outils de surveillance.

Des alarmes personnalisées vous permettent de décider quand et comment vous recevrez des alertes. Les meilleurs outils vous permettent de définir le niveau de gravité et les seuils qui déclenchent une alarme. Vous avez également la possibilité de désactiver les alarmes, d'exiger l'acquittement manuel de certaines alarmes ou d'exclure des alarmes pour certaines valeurs.

Des alarmes intelligentes sont disponibles avec certains outils de surveillance. Ces alarmes vous indiquent non seulement qu'il y a un problème, mais offrent également des solutions possibles. Avec une interface intuitive et facile à interpréter, les alarmes intelligentes vous montrent ce qui s'est passé juste avant et après le déclenchement de l'alarme pour faciliter le diagnostic et la correction.

Le suivi de l'historique des alarmes de votre système fournit un aperçu complet des problèmes de performances récurrents ou des événements qui déclenchent de fausses alarmes afin qu'ils puissent être résolus.

La surveillance proactive de la base de données crée une ligne de base de débit

La surveillance proactive de la base de données offre une valeur ajoutée au-delà de l'identification des problèmes de performances au fur et à mesure qu'ils surviennent. Le suivi proactif des données crée une référence par rapport à laquelle toutes les opérations peuvent être mesurées.

La définition d'une ligne de base de fonctionnement normal vous permettra de savoir quand tout le système fonctionne bien, ce qui est particulièrement important après les mises à jour et les événements de maintenance importants. Les données de base peuvent également être utilisées pour identifier les écarts inattendus qui peuvent indiquer qu'une défaillance du système est imminente.

Savoir à quoi ressemble la "normale" pour vos bases de données facilite la définition de seuils d'alerte réalistes pour minimiser les fausses alarmes et les efforts de triage inutiles.

Dans presque toutes les situations, lorsqu'on leur donne le choix, il est préférable de résoudre un problème de manière proactive plutôt que de devoir réagir sur le moment. En ce qui concerne la surveillance des performances de la base de données, la création d'une stratégie de surveillance proactive aidera à prévenir les problèmes qui ralentissent les temps de chargement, les pannes et l'indisponibilité du système, ainsi que d'autres facteurs qui nuisent aux performances et qui finiront par affecter négativement les utilisateurs externes, les opérations internes et peut-être même les revenus de l'entreprise.